Understanding the Basics of Homeschooling in Kuwait

So, before we jump into the nitty-gritty of PSE and SESE, let's get a handle on the fundamentals of homeschooling in Kuwait. Homeschooling in Kuwait, like in many other countries, isn't just about learning at home; it’s about taking full responsibility for your child's education. This means you, the parent, become the primary educator. You'll be responsible for curriculum development, lesson planning, teaching, and assessing your child's progress. But don't let that intimidate you! There are tons of resources, support groups, and online platforms designed to make the process smoother and more enjoyable. It is essential to ensure that your child receives an education that meets the standards set by the Kuwaiti Ministry of Education, even though the approach is different from traditional schooling.

One of the main benefits of homeschooling is the ability to tailor the curriculum to your child's individual learning style and pace. This flexibility can be a huge advantage for children who may struggle in a traditional classroom setting or those who have unique interests and talents. You can create a learning environment that nurtures their curiosity and fosters a love of learning. Homeschooling also offers a great deal of flexibility in terms of scheduling. You can structure your days to fit your family's lifestyle, whether you're early birds or night owls. This flexibility allows for extracurricular activities, field trips, and other enriching experiences that might be difficult to incorporate into a traditional school day. However, it's also important to acknowledge the challenges. Homeschooling requires a significant time commitment, and it can be isolating at times. It is crucial to have a plan and resources. SESE (Special Education Services and Evaluation) and Homeschooling

Now, let's shift gears and talk about SESE! If your child has special educational needs, understanding the role of SESE is paramount. SESE (Special Education Services and Evaluation) provides support and resources for children with disabilities or learning differences. If your child has been diagnosed with a learning disability, att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), autism spectrum disorder (ASD), or any other special educational need, SESE can be an invaluable resource. They can provide evaluations to assess your child’s needs, which will help to determine the necessary support and accommodations. SESE also offers various services, including specialized educational programs, therapy services, and assistive technologies. The first step involves getting your child evaluated by qualified professionals. The evaluation will help determine the nature and extent of your child's needs.

Homeschooling a child with special needs can be immensely rewarding, as it allows for personalized instruction and a tailored learning environment. However, it also requires additional planning, resources, and support. Working with SESE can provide you with the necessary guidance and assistance to meet your child's unique needs. SESE can help you develop an Individualized Education Program (IEP). An IEP is a plan that outlines your child’s specific educational goals, the services and accommodations they will receive, and how their progress will be measured. It serves as a roadmap to ensure that your child receives appropriate and effective education. The IEP is a collaborative effort involving you, SESE professionals, and any other relevant specialists. It's a dynamic document that can be adjusted as your child's needs evolve.

Resources and Support Systems for Homeschooling in Kuwait

Alright, let’s talk resources! Homeschooling in Kuwait doesn’t mean going it alone. There are plenty of resources and support systems available to help you on your homeschooling journey. These resources can range from online platforms and curriculum providers to local homeschooling groups and educational specialists. Online platforms are a great way to access a wealth of educational materials, including lesson plans, worksheets, and interactive activities. Many platforms offer pre-designed curricula, which can save you time and effort in planning your lessons. They offer a wide range of subjects and grade levels. Some platforms also provide assessment tools to track your child's progress. Be sure to explore different options and find a platform that aligns with your child's learning style and your teaching preferences. Curriculum providers offer comprehensive educational materials that are specifically designed for homeschooling. These providers often offer a complete curriculum package that includes textbooks, workbooks, and other resources. You can choose from various curricula, including traditional and alternative approaches. Carefully review the curriculum's content and approach. Make sure it aligns with your child's learning needs and your family's educational philosophy. Homeschooling support groups and communities are an excellent way to connect with other homeschooling families in Kuwait. These groups provide opportunities to share experiences, ask questions, and offer support. They can also organize social events, field trips, and other activities that can enrich your child's learning experience. You can find these groups online through social media, online forums, and local community websites. Local educational specialists, such as tutors and therapists, can provide additional support and guidance. These specialists can offer personalized instruction in specific subjects or help address any learning challenges your child may face. Consider enlisting the help of an experienced tutor or educational therapist, who can help your child succeed. If your child has special needs, consider specialists to help support them. Always do your research to ensure that the specialists are qualified and experienced.
